Comprehending Wire Mesh: Types, Uses, and Benefits
Wire mesh is a versatile material used in a wide variety of applications. Its design typically involves interlacing thin wires with each other a strong and durable structure. There are numerous kinds of wire mesh, each with its own unique properties, making it ideal for specific purposes.
Some common cases include woven wire mesh, welded wire mesh, and expanded metal mesh.
Woven wire mesh is created by interlacing wires at right angles, resulting in a tightly fastened framework. It's often used for applications requiring separation, such as gauzes.
Welded wire mesh is made by welding wires together at their intersections. This creates a robust and firm framework ideal for applications like cage construction.
Expanded metal mesh is made by punching diamond-shaped openings from a sheet of metal. This results in a lightweight and pliable structure that's often applied for applications like decorative elements.

Picking the Right Wire Mesh for Your Project
Wire mesh is a versatile material used in a wide spectrum of applications. From construction to production, wire mesh provides click here strength, durability, and flexibility. However, with so many different types of wire mesh available, choosing the right one for your specific project can be difficult.
Consider the function of the wire mesh. What are you using it for?
A popular useis screening, where wire mesh is used to separate materials based on size. Other applications include structural support, security barriers, and decorative elements.
Once you know the primary function of the wire mesh, you can narrow down your choices based on the type of wire, the weave pattern, and the gauge. The type of wire used in construction impacts the strength and durability of the mesh. Steel are some common choices. The weave pattern, such as knitted, affects the openness and strength of the mesh. Finally, the gauge, which refers to the thickness of the wire, determines the overall durability of the mesh.
In conclusion, choosing the right wire mesh involves carefully considering your project's needs and the properties of different types of wire mesh. By taking the time to research and compare your options, you can select a material that is both suitable for your specific application and affordable.
